"No, because I think I have a reason to believe in myself and I think I'm also pretty confident about who I am and what I'm doing and it might be because I'm still at the top too"
About this Quote
The subtext is about authority in a sport that constantly tries to strip it away, especially from young women who dominate early. Hingis isn’t selling swagger; she’s defending legitimacy. “Who I am and what I’m doing” pushes past trophies into identity, a line that lands harder when you remember how tennis narrates careers as either ascent or decline, genius or burnout. Confidence becomes not a personality trait but a survival skill in an ecosystem built on weekly judgment.
Then comes the kicker: “it might be because I’m still at the top too.” The “might” is strategic understatement; the “too” is the blade. She knows results are the only currency that shuts down questions about whether you deserve to believe in yourself. It’s a subtle rebuke to the premise that confidence must be earned through suffering or self-doubt. Hingis frames self-belief as rational, not mystical: evidence-based, backed by winning, and resistant to the culture’s appetite for a champion’s vulnerability as entertainment.
